The black box sitting above the school bus lettering represents the Wi-Fi antenna on a Kanawha County school bus in West Virginia. The district currently has 175 of its 196 school buses equipped with the technology.
As school districts look toward virtual or blended learning styles for the new school year, equipping school buses with
Wi-Fi routers can help even out the educational equities unveiled during the previous year.
